Glencore Plchas priced a CHF250 million bond, maturing May 2021, at a yield of 2.25%, Reutersreported April 26.
This was the first bond offering since the company was effectivelylocked out of the debt markets in September 2015 when concerns over its abilityto manage borrowings sent its equities and bonds into a downward spiral.
The mining major opened its books the same day, looking to raisea minimum of CHF150 million, with an indicative yield of 2.25%.
Lead managers Credit Suisse and UBS upsized the deal three timesdue to strong demand.
The new issue will help to refinance an CHF825 million maturitythat was paid earlier this month and an upcoming US$1.33 billion fixed and floatdeal due in May.
